I get that opinion, and I can even agree to an extent. Certainly the menuing is annoying and that's not even something they fixed by Dawn, instead band-aiding it by just letting you 'hot swap'. I like how spells work conceptually, and in general I'm a big proponent of players having tools from the very beginning and learning of them later on so that they can always be utilized by somebody who knows. And I do wish that, not unlike you said, if even it were just Guardian Souls running on an MP bar with Bullet Souls running off hearts, it would alleviate some of the tedium of having to pick or choose. I think that would be an ideal form of the system alongside some fabled quick-select or favorites tab of Souls you could switch between on command. Obviously, on a console with more buttons than just A/B/Start/Select, I'd like to imagine that would be the case (just ignore Dawn).
That said, I think it only works in Symphony because every spell is a Dracula spell. Now that goes a bit for souls as well but hear me out. Contextually, Soma has zero traits of Dracula at the beginning of the game and Alucard has been toiling around since CV3. It makes perfect sense that Alucard comes loaded with a bunch of spells he can fire off that not even Death can take from him at the beginning, while Soma only has whatever he can claw out from the enemies he encounters. From the story standpoint, the spells and souls both make sense in how they are handled and I appreciate how the function in tandem with the plot.

Both are phenomenal, but I personally prefer AoS to SotN. AoS generally has everything SotN has in terms of the variety of equipment, lite RPG mechanics, and mobility unlocks, but the soul system feels like it doubles the content in some ways. Every single enemy having a unique soul was phenomenal as a gimmick. Whether it was a general stat boost, a projectile, an entire unique form, or even changed the way you played entirely (health absorb, drop kicks, extreme speed dashing), it all made for such a unique experience.

Also, I'd argue AoS is much more tight overall. I adore SotN and the upside down/inverted castle, but a lot of the second half of the game feels poorly designed. Tons of areas in the inverted castle are fucking packed with enemies that feel copy pasted rather than properly thought through. A bunch of rooms are outright empty or missing any real reason to explore it as well. Also, since you mostly have all of your mobility tools by that point, you can sometimes feel a bit mindless in how you go through areas since nothing's stopping you or asking you to find some alternative path since you're missing an ability.

SotN generally looks way better, has better music, puzzles, and way more content all around. But I often come away feeling a bit tired by the time I'm done replaying it, whereas AoS always feels like it ends right when I'm satisfied. It's overall way more of a tight experience comparatively.
